首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

确定用户是否为成年人(discord.py)

确定用户是否为成年人是通过discord.py库实现的。discord.py是一个用于构建聊天机器人和应用程序的Python库,特别适用于与Discord聊天平台进行交互。

要确定用户是否为成年人,可以通过以下步骤:

  1. 首先,需要获取用户的年龄信息。可以通过discord.py提供的API方法来获取用户的年龄。
  2. 接下来,可以使用一个条件语句来检查用户的年龄是否满足成年人的标准。成年人的标准可以根据具体情况而定,通常是18岁或21岁。
  3. 如果用户的年龄符合成年人的标准,可以向用户发送一条信息,确认其为成年人。可以使用discord.py提供的API方法来发送消息。

以下是一个示例代码:

代码语言:txt
复制
import discord
from discord.ext import commands

bot = commands.Bot(command_prefix='!')

@bot.command()
async def check_adult(ctx, age: int):
    if age >= 18:
        await ctx.send("您是成年人!")
    else:
        await ctx.send("您未满18岁!")

bot.run('YOUR_BOT_TOKEN')

在上面的代码中,首先创建了一个discord.py的Bot实例,并定义了一个命令check_adult,该命令接受一个整数参数age,表示用户的年龄。

check_adult命令的实现中,使用了一个条件语句来检查用户的年龄是否满足成年人的标准。如果满足条件,则通过await ctx.send()方法向用户发送一条确认信息。

要运行上述代码,需要替换YOUR_BOT_TOKEN为您的Discord机器人的令牌。然后,可以在Discord聊天平台上使用!check_adult命令来检查用户的年龄。

腾讯云并没有直接相关的产品来确定用户是否为成年人。但可以使用腾讯云的云服务器(CVM)来运行上述代码,并将其与Discord聊天平台集成。您可以使用腾讯云的CVM产品来搭建和管理云服务器。详情请参考腾讯云CVM产品介绍:https://cloud.tencent.com/product/cvm

请注意,上述答案是基于discord.py库和腾讯云产品进行了讨论和建议。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

5分36秒

2.19.卢卡斯素性测试lucas primality test

10分18秒

2.14.米勒拉宾素性检验Miller-Rabin primality test

6分41秒

2.8.素性检验之车轮分解wheel factorization

4分28秒

2.20.波克林顿检验pocklington primality test

5分10秒

2.18.索洛瓦-施特拉森素性测试Solovay-Strassen primality test

1分41秒

视频监控智能分析系统

领券